r39 - trunk/src/target/package_manager/src

caowai_song at gta01.hmw-consulting.de caowai_song at gta01.hmw-consulting.de
Mon Aug 28 08:16:26 CEST 2006


Author: caowai_song
Date: 2006-08-28 06:16:17 +0000 (Mon, 28 Aug 2006)
New Revision: 39

Modified:
   trunk/src/target/package_manager/src/detareamgr.c
Log:
Fix a bug that translate a NULL to function gtk_text_buffer_set_text().



Modified: trunk/src/target/package_manager/src/detareamgr.c
===================================================================
--- trunk/src/target/package_manager/src/detareamgr.c	2006-08-28 02:29:59 UTC (rev 38)
+++ trunk/src/target/package_manager/src/detareamgr.c	2006-08-28 06:16:17 UTC (rev 39)
@@ -188,7 +188,10 @@
   if (depview != NULL)
     {
       buffer = gtk_text_view_get_buffer (GTK_TEXT_VIEW (depview));
-      gtk_text_buffer_set_text (buffer, detail->depends, -1);
+      if (detail->depends != NULL)
+        gtk_text_buffer_set_text (buffer, detail->depends, -1);
+      else
+        gtk_text_buffer_set_text (buffer, "", -1);
     }
 
 }
@@ -207,7 +210,10 @@
   if (tvsummary != NULL)
     {
       buffer = gtk_text_view_get_buffer (GTK_TEXT_VIEW (tvsummary));
-      gtk_text_buffer_set_text (buffer, detail->description, -1);
+      if (detail->description != NULL)
+        gtk_text_buffer_set_text (buffer, detail->description, -1);
+      else
+        gtk_text_buffer_set_text (buffer, "", -1);
     }
 
 }





More information about the commitlog mailing list